‘All the funds raised in Centralia, stay in Centralia’
The Salvation Army bells will ring again in Centralia at Prenger Foods. Shifts are available on Saturday December 5, December 12 and December 19.
The times are 9 a.m. -1 p.m. in one hour shifts.
Organizers request masks and social distancing be employed. All money raised stays local.
Money from the Centralia Salvation Army helps with utilities, food and other necessities for local families. A family can only request help once in a calendar year. Money from last year’s bell ringing is providing gift cards to all the Community for Kids families for groceries.
Angel Trees have also gone up Kinkeads and Prengers.
Gifts need to be wrapped and returned to the store by December 15.
